Goldman Sachs Sees Sizable Stake Boost from Ameritas Advisory
Ameritas Advisory Services LLC has increased its stake in The Goldman Sachs Group Inc. (NYSE:GS) by 212.7% during the second quarter, according to a recent Form 13F filing with the SEC.
The firm now owns 3,227 shares of GS's stock after acquiring an additional 2,195 shares during the quarter.
Ameritas Advisory Services LLC's holdings in The Goldman Sachs Group were worth $3.26 million at the end of the most recent reporting period.
Several other institutional investors and hedge funds have also recently modified their holdings of GS. Strive Financial Group LLC raised its position in The Goldman Sachs Group by 316.7% during the second quarter, while BOK Financial Private Wealth Inc. grew its position by 188.9% during the same period.
The Goldman Sachs Group has a market capitalization of $301.36 billion and a P/E ratio of 15.97. The firm's fifty day simple moving average is $1,044.54, while its two-hundred day simple moving average is $973.81.
